Gerald John Caputo

June 5, 1936 — February 10, 2013

Gerald John Caputo, 76, of Oregon, Ohio passed away on Sunday, February 10, 2013 surrounded by his loving family and canine companion, Trini.  Jerry was born on June 5, 1936 to Biagio Caputo and Lucia DeMaria in Ravenna, Ohio. He attended Waite High School and served in the U.S. Marines, during the Korean War.

Jerry was a conductor and yardmaster for CSX Railroad for 35 years.  He attended Mayfair Plymouth Congregational Christian Church.  He loved traveling to the Carolinas, New England and Florida.  His greatest love was being surrounded by his children and grandchildren.
He was preceded in death by his parents, Stepmother, Rose (Arrigo) Caputo; brother, Ben Caputo Jr., son Gerald Caputo Jr.; sister, Carol Jean Heiges; first wife, Janet Barber.  He is survived by his loving wife of 30 years, Karen, sons, Michael (Laurie) Caputo, Scott (Angela) Giffin; grandsons, Tony (Rachel) Caputo, Markus Caputo, Scott and Aaron Giffin, great-grandsons, Preston and Konnor; sister, Dianne Mallory of Lodi, CA., Nick Caputo of Banning, CA., Joe (Paulla) of W. Covina, CA., John (Joanne) of Spokane, WA.; sister-in-law, Carol Caputo of Toledo, OH.; special aunt, Margy Emmick of Toledo and uncle, Danny Caputo of Florida.  He is also survived by many loving nieces, nephews and cousins.
